A while ago while browsing another site
I read a thread about how most GS11xx centre stands are neglected/worn due to the fact it's a total PITA to lube them because you need to take them off to do it, I made a mental note to have a look next time I got a chance, then forgot!
Finally got round to having a look & really glad I did, my bikes got 35Kkms on it but the stand & bushings were in a bit of a mess, very little lube & already showing signs of "galling"
though I do tend to use the centre stand a lot.
The stand swivels on steel bushes with "O" rings to keep dirt out, these also prevent any applied lube going in. I simply drilled a 2mm countersunk hole in the stand at each side (between the O rings!) to use a conical grease gun on now & again, could put grease nipples on but would probably be overkill.
The sidestand has a small lube hole, wonder why the centre stand doesn't?
